You can try downloading this GNU/linux binary of Carsten's programme
to see if it helps:
http://www.bozzograo.net/radiance/modules.php?op=modload&name=Downloads&file=index&req=viewdownload&cid=4
You can also use the eulumcnv.exe binary
http://www.helios32.com/eulumcnv.exe
from Gnu/Linux using wine (wine eulumcnv.exe file.ldt)
To install wine on Ubuntu or any Debian based distro:
sudo apt-get install wine
The extension for the eulumdat file should not have any impact
on the converters, as long as the file follows the Eulumdat standard:
http://www.helios32.com/Eulumdat.htm
For more info on the IES standard:
http://lumen.iee.put.poznan.pl/kw/iesna.txt
You can easily build your own IES file using this information
from a table of candela values, that is already in your eulumdat file.
